Strawberry Cardamom Cupcakes with Strawberry Basil Buttercream Recipe

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 12 1x

Description

Strawberry cardamom cupcakes blend Mediterranean spice with sweet summer fruit, creating a delicate dessert that surprises and delights. Luscious strawberry basil buttercream crowns these elegant treats, promising pure culinary bliss for anyone seeking a refined and unexpected flavor experience.


Ingredients

Scale

Primary Ingredients:

  • 2 ¼ cups (532 ml) all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up plus 2 tablespoons (255 g) s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 8 tablespoons (113 g) unsalted butter, softened
  • 12 tablespoons (170 g) unsalted butter, softened
  • 2 egg whites
  • 1 cup plus 2 tablespoons (255 g) sugar

Spices and Flavoring Ingredients:

  • 1 teaspoon ground cardamom
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¼ cup (15 g) finely chopped basil

Liquid and Additional Ingredients:

  • ½ tablespo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up (120 ml) whole milk
  • ¾ cup (177 ml) pureed strawberries
  • ½ cup (118 ml) pureed strawberries

Instructions

  1. Meticulously prepare the oven environment by warming it to 350°F and positioning cupcake liners within the muffin tin.
  2. Thoroughly combine dry ingredients – flour, baking powder, salt, and ground cardamom – in a comprehensive mixing vessel.
  3. Utilize a stand mixer to cream butter and sugar until the mixture achieves a luminous, airy consistency.
  4. Incorporate eggs individually, ensuring thorough integration after each addition.
  5. Create a liquid blend of milk and vanilla extract, then systematically alternate between dry mixture and milk combination while mixing at low speed.
  6. Gently fold pureed strawberries into the batter, ensuring uniform distribution.
  7. Carefully allocate batter among cupcake liners, filling each approximately three-quarters full.
  8. Transfer the muffin tin to the preheated oven, allowing cupcakes to bake for 20-25 minutes until they demonstrate resilient surfaces and pass the toothpick test.
  9. Allow cupcakes to rest momentarily in the pan, then transition to a cooling rack for complete temperature reduction.
  10. Construct the Swiss meringue buttercream by whisking egg whites and sugar over a water bath, maintaining consistent movement until sugar dissolves and mixture reaches 160°F.
  11. Transfer the heated mixture to a stand mixer, whisking at medium-high velocity until robust peaks form.
  12. Gradually introduce butter fragments, maintaining consistent mixing until fully amalgamated.
  13. Incorporate finely chopped basil, continuing to whisk until peaks re-establish themselves.
  14. Switch to paddle attachment, cautiously blend pureed strawberries at low speed.
  15. Once cupcakes have thoroughly cooled, artfully apply strawberry basil buttercream.
  16. Elevate presentation by drizzling residual strawberry puree and adorning with delicate edible rose petals.

Notes

  • Master the art of precise ingredient measurement for consistently perfect cupcakes every single time.
  • Ground cardamom adds a warm, exotic spice that beautifully complements the sweet strawberry flavor, creating a sophisticated dessert experience.
  • Swiss meringue buttercream requires patience and careful temperature control to achieve its silky, luxurious texture.
  • Fresh strawberry puree ensures intense fruit flavor and natural moisture throughout the cupcake, preventing dryness.
  • Allow cupcakes to cool completely before frosting to prevent buttercream from melting and losing its delicate structure.
  • Edible rose petals offer an elegant, Instagram-worthy finishing touch that elevates the presentation from simple to extraordinary.
